Разгадка секретов его правления

Поскольку мир искусственного интеллекта (ИИ) продолжает развиваться быстрыми темпами, разработчикам и исследователям требуется язык программирования, способный идти в ногу со временем.

Введите Python, правящего короля языков программирования ИИ. Благодаря своей простоте, универсальности и обширной поддержке библиотек Python быстро поднялся на вершину, став предпочтительным выбором для разработчиков ИИ.

Но что именно делает Python монархом в этой области и чем он отличается от других популярных языков программирования? Давайте погрузимся и раскроем секреты прочного доминирования Python.

Краеугольный камень: простота и элегантность Python

Восхождение Python на трон можно объяснить его основной философией — простотой и элегантностью. В мире, где программирование ИИ может быстро стать сложным и непосильным, чистый, удобочитаемый синтаксис Python — это глоток свежего воздуха.



Его простота позволяет как новичкам, так и опытным разработчикам сосредоточиться на своей работе, не увязая в громоздких языковых причудах. Результат? Более быстрые циклы разработки и более эффективное решение проблем. Но не верьте нам на слово.

Как вы относитесь к простоте Python по сравнению с другими языками, с которыми вы работали?

Универсальность: королевская черта Python

Универсальность Python — еще одна жемчужина в его короне. Как язык программирования общего назначения, Python подходит для широкого спектра приложений, от веб-разработки до анализа данных.

Его гибкость делает его популярным выбором не только для разработки ИИ, но и для разработчиков, работающих над смежными задачами, такими как машинное обучение и наука о данных.

Когда дело доходит до разработки ИИ, универсальность Python позволяет легко интегрировать его с другими языками и платформами, что делает его мощным инструментом в арсенале любого разработчика.

Какие проекты вы реализовали, используя универсальность Python в своих интересах?



Верные предметы Python: обширные библиотеки и поддержка сообщества

Ни один король не может править без лояльных подданных, и Питон не исключение. Одной из основных причин, по которой Python стал лучшим выбором для программирования ИИ, является его обширная коллекция библиотек и фреймворков.

Такие библиотеки, как TensorFlow, PyTorch и Keras, играют важную роль в оптимизации разработки ИИ, предоставляя разработчикам готовые инструменты и функции, которые экономят время и упрощают работу.

Кроме того, Python может похвастаться большим активным сообществом разработчиков, которые вносят свой вклад в его постоянно растущую экосистему.

Эта сеть поддержки не только гарантирует актуальность и актуальность Python, но также предоставляет ценные ресурсы и возможности для обмена знаниями для разработчиков ИИ.

Как сообщество Python повлияло на ваше путешествие по программированию ИИ?

Королевское соперничество: Python против других языков программирования

Хотя Python, несомненно, лидирует в сфере программирования ИИ, его стоит сравнить с другими популярными языками, такими как Java, C++ и R.

Java, например, известна своей мобильностью и высокой производительностью, что делает ее подходящим соперником в некоторых сценариях разработки ИИ.

C++, с другой стороны, предлагает более высокий уровень контроля и оптимизации производительности, что может быть полезно в конкретных приложениях ИИ.

R, язык, разработанный специально для анализа данных и статистики, также хорошо зарекомендовал себя в сфере ИИ, особенно когда речь идет об обработке и визуализации данных.

Однако универсальность и простота использования Python в конечном итоге дают ему преимущество над конкурентами на арене ИИ.

Как вы думаете, чем Python отличается от других языков программирования, когда дело доходит до разработки ИИ?



Будущее Python в программировании ИИ

Поскольку ИИ продолжает развиваться и изменять наш мир, роль Python в этой революции кажется более важной, чем когда-либо.

Благодаря своей простоте, универсальности и обширной поддержке библиотек Python готов сохранить свое господство в сфере программирования ИИ в обозримом будущем.

Поскольку разработчики и исследователи продолжают раздвигать границы ИИ, Python, несомненно, останется важным инструментом в их арсенале.

Итак, какое будущее ждет Python в области программирования ИИ? Будет ли он продолжать господствовать или появятся новые языки, чтобы бросить вызов его господству?

Только время покажет, но на данный момент Python не проявляет никаких признаков отказа от своей короны.

По мере того, как мы изучаем постоянно меняющийся ландшафт ИИ, крайне важно непредвзято относиться к инструментам и языкам, которые мы используем. Хотя Python в настоящее время доминирует в мире программирования ИИ, важно быть в курсе новых технологий и языков, которые потенциально могут предложить новые и инновационные подходы к разработке ИИ.

Итак, продолжая свое путешествие в мире программирования ИИ, не забывайте оставаться любопытными, адаптируемыми и открытыми для изменений. Кто знает, возможно, однажды вы станете частью следующей революции языков программирования.

А пока да здравствует Python, бесспорный король программирования ИИ!

Что вы думаете о господстве Python в мире программирования ИИ? Сталкивались ли вы с какими-либо проблемами или ограничениями в своих проектах ИИ с использованием Python? Поделитесь своим опытом и идеями в комментариях ниже!

Понравилась эта статья? Не забудьте подписаться на меня, чтобы получать больше подобного контента!

  1. Твиттер: @alexnorthwood_
  2. Если вы нашли эту статью полезной, пожалуйста, нажмите кнопку «Подписаться» в моем профиле. Следуя за мной, вы будете получать уведомления, когда я публикую новые статьи и идеи, которые могут вам помочь.
  3. Не стесняйтесь поделиться этой статьей со своими друзьями и в сети, и давайте продолжим разговор в комментариях ниже. Буду рад услышать ваши мысли и опыт!
  4. Дальнейшее чтение: